计算与信息科学
计算与信息科学是一个充满活力和创新的领域,它涵盖了从硬件到软件、从理论到应用的各种知识和技能。在这个信息爆炸的时代,计算与信息科学不仅在推动技术进步中发挥着关键作用,也深刻影响着我们的日常生活。以下是对这个领域的几个重要方面的探讨。
1. 计算机的基本原理
计算机的基础知识是理解计算与信息科学的关键。从二进制系统到数据在计算机中的表示,再到计算机的工作流程,这些概念为我们提供了操作和编程计算机的基本工具。了解这些原理可以帮助我们更好地利用计算机来解决实际问题。
2. 编程语言与软件开发
编程语言是软件开发的核心。从初级的Python到高级的C++,每种语言都有其独特的应用场景。软件开发不仅仅涉及编写代码,还包括需求分析、设计、测试和维护等各个阶段。掌握软件开发流程对于构建可靠和高效的软件系统至关重要。
3. 数据科学与大数据分析
随着数据量的爆炸式增长,如何有效地收集、存储、处理和分析数据成为了关键问题。数据科学和大数据分析为我们提供了处理和理解海量数据的方法和工具。通过这些技术,我们可以从数据中提取出有价值的洞察,为决策提供支持。
4. 人工智能与机器学习
人工智能(AI)和机器学习(ML)是当前科技领域的热门话题。AI和ML技术正在改变我们的生活方式,从自动驾驶汽车到智能家居,再到医疗诊断。机器学习算法使得计算机能够从数据中学习并做出决策,这为自动化和智能化系统提供了可能。
5. 网络安全与隐私保护
随着互联网的普及,网络安全成为了每个人和每个组织都需要关注的问题。从个人隐私到国家网络安全,保护数据免受恶意攻击和泄露至关重要。网络安全专家致力于开发和实施各种策略和技术,以确保信息系统的安全性。
计算与信息科学是一个不断发展的领域,它要求我们不断学习新的知识和技能。无论是硬件工程师、软件开发人员、数据分析师还是网络安全专家,这个领域为各种兴趣和技能的人提供了广阔的职业发展机会。随着技术的不断进步,我们可以预见,计算与信息科学将继续推动社会的数字化转型,并创造出更多令人兴奋的可能性。